Ingredients Needed for Pineapple and Ricotta Tower

1 cup brown sugar
6 pineapples slices
1 cup ricotta
1 tablespoon vanilla extract
¼ cup raisin
chocolate sauce
pomegranate seed

How to Make Pineapple and Ricotta Tower

  1. Heat a skillet and add brown sugar. Melt it into a sauce. Add the pineapple slices and cover them with caramel.
  2. Use a large bowl and add ricotta, vanilla extract, and raisins. Mix them together into a cream.
  3. Place the pineapple slices one on top of the other and with ricotta between them. Fill the middle with chocolate sauce. Finally sprinkle pomegranate seeds on top.
